Protein-rich whole foods Prioritise these protein sources in your diet: Lean meats : Chicken breast (31g protein per 100g), turkey (29g per 100g), lean beef (26g per 100g) Fish and seafood : Salmon (25g per 100g), tuna (30g per 100g), prawns (24g per 100g) Eggs : 6-7g protein per medium egg Dairy : Greek yoghurt (10g per 100g), parmesan (30g per 100g), and cottage cheese (12g per 100g) Plant proteins : Tofu (10-15g per 100g), lentils (9g per 100g), chickpeas (7g per 100g), quinoa (4g per 100g) Tips to increase protein intake To maximise protein intake while dealing with Mounjaros hunger-lowering effects: Include protein in every meal and snack Consider eating protein-rich foods first in your meal Spread protein intake throughout the day rather than consuming it all at once Prepare smaller, more frequent protein-rich meals if large meals are difficult to tolerate Try softer protein sources like yoghurt, eggs, or fish if digestive symptoms are present The Second Nature balanced plate To ensure youre getting adequate protein alongside other essential nutrients, follow the Second Nature balanced plate model: 1/4 of your plate as protein sources 1/4 as complex carbohydrates 1/2 as non-starchy vegetables A serving of fat the size of your thumb This approach helps ensure youre not just getting protein, but also the energy, fibre, vitamins, and minerals needed for overall health during weight loss
